How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wilson?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wilson Studio Apartments | $1,667 | $865 | $2,198 |
| Wilson 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,366 | $895 | $10,000+ |
| Wilson 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,555 | $1,065 | $4,488 |
| Wilson 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,042 | $1,295 | $4,250 |
| Wilson 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,800 | $1,800 | $1,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wilson
How much are Studio apartments in Wilson?
There are currently 8 Studio Apartments in Wilson with rent ranges from $865 to $2,198 with an average price of $1,667.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wilson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wilson ranges from $895 to $11,649 with an average monthly rent of $1,366.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wilson c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wilson range from $1,065 to $4,488.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,555.
How expensive are Wilson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wilson on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,295 to $4,250 - averaging $2,042 for the location.
